labored

英 ['leibәd]

a. 吃力的, 缓慢的, 不自然的, 矫揉造作的

双语例句

  • You can hear his labored breathing.
    你能听到他费力的呼吸声。
  • The car labored up the steep hill.
    车子吃力地向陡峭的山上开去。
  • For many corporations, borrowing short-term money from banks is often a labored and annoying task.
    对大多数公司来说,向银行短期借款常常被称为费力和烦恼的任务。
  • The labored breathing of a very ill person.
    一个病入膏肓的人的费力呼吸。
  • Tellus was an honest man who labored hard for many years to bring up his children.
    特勒斯是个老实人,他多年辛勤劳动,抚育他的孩子。
  • I took any opportunity I could to visit him, even as his speech and breathing became labored.
    我找到一切可能的机会去看他,甚至在他说话和呼吸都很费力的时候。
  • Since ancient times, our ancestors lived and labored on this land.
    自古以来,我们的祖先在这块土地上劳动、生活。
  • He labored the point so that the audience lost interest.
    他过分详细地解释论点使听众失去兴趣。
  • It was hard work digging down, and they both labored in a tense and strained silence.
    接下来的挖掘更加困难,他们都被一种紧张情绪牵系着,默不作声地工作着。
  • All day long I labored alone in the front room.
    我整天独自一人在前屋里劳作。
